Turinys:
2025 Autorius: John Day | [email protected]. Paskutinį kartą keistas: 2025-01-13 06:57
Atminkite, išjunkite šviesą, išgelbėkite Žemę.
Šis prietaisas padeda man išmokti išsiugdyti įprotį išjungti šviesą, kai išeinu iš savo kambario.
Prietaisą tiesiog sukūrė „Arduino“, daugiausia naudodamas šviesos jutiklį, ultragarsinį atstumo matavimo prietaisą ir LED lemputę.
Tai primena, kad, jei pamirštu, išjunkite šviesą, uždegus už durų prilipusią LED lemputę.
Prekės
Šviesos sensorius
Ultragarsinis atstumo matavimo prietaisas
LCD ekranas
LED lemputė
Aligatoriaus spaustukai su pigtailais
Įvairių tipų laidai
Gražiai atrodanti dėžutė
1 žingsnis: įrenginio struktūra
Yra 5 pagrindinės dalys, dėl kurių prietaisas veikia:
A-šviesos jutiklis: nustato šviesos spindulių vertę (ar šviesa įjungiama arba išjungiama) ir sutvarko koduojant
B-ultragarsinis atstumo matavimo prietaisas: nustato durų atstumą ir pagal kodavimą nustato, kad pagrindinis dalykas yra nustatyti, ar durys yra atidarytos, ar ne
C-LCD ekranas: rodo atstumo skaičių, kad būtų lengviau nustatyti ultragarsinio atstumo matavimo prietaiso kodą
D-LED lemputė: objektas, kuris pašviesėjo, lengvai pastebimas kaip priminimas
„E-Alligator“spaustukai su „pigtails“: leidžia LED lemputę pasiekti lauke
2 žingsnis: kodavimas
1. nustatykite LCD ekraną, kad būtų parodytas atstumas, kurį aptiko ultragarsinis atstumo matavimo prietaisas.
2. sukurkite „jei/kitaip“logiką su dviem sąlygomis:
a) jei šviesos spindulių vertė didesnė nei 500 --- šviesa įsijungė
b) jei atstumas trumpesnis nei 93 --- durys atsidarė (išėjo iš kambario)
-jei a) ir b) abi sąlygos tinka-LED lemputė už durų užsidegs (primena jums išjungti šviesą)
-jei viena iš jų a) arba b) sąlygos netinka-už durų esanti LED lemputė neužsidegs (jūs vis dar esate savo kambaryje arba pamenate išjungti šviesą arba abu)
3 žingsnis: pakeiskite išvaizdą
Niekas nenorėtų, kad prietaisas, pilnas laidų, būtų ant jų kambario žemės.
Tiesiog įdėkite prietaisą į dėžutę, kuri atrodo gražiai.
*Svarbu nedėti jutiklio ir detektoriaus į dėžutę, nes kitaip jis neveiks.
4 žingsnis: kaip tai veikia realybėje
Kai išeinu iš kambario su įjungtomis šviesomis, užsidega priminimo LED lemputė.
Kai išeinu iš kambario su išjungtomis šviesomis, priminimo šviesos diodas neveiks.
5 žingsnis: atspindys
Šis projektas padeda man išmokti išsiugdyti įprotį išjungti šviesą, kai išeinu iš savo kambario. Ir aš išmokau savarankiškai kurti prietaisą nuo projektavimo iki gamybos. Tai taip pat pagerino mano gebėjimą įgyti „Arduino“įgūdžių ir valdyti krizę. Manau, kad turiu daug geresnių įgūdžių, nei maniau anksčiau, ir tai kelia mano pasitikėjimą. Nekantriai laukiu kito projekto ir siekiu didesnio iššūkio.